Well, right now I'm watching a movie on my laptop, which is sitting right beside the monitor of my desktop computer. (LOL. This is how I work!) The movie is on Hulu.com called "Disconnected". It's a one hour documentary that follows 3 college students who are going computer-less for 3 weeks.

Considering how hard it would be for me to "disconnect", and I can't imagine how much more difficult it is for these kids who are about half my age! They literally don't know any other way. I just got the biggest kick out of watching them try to figure out a typewriter (couldn't load the paper) and look for the "delete" button. ROFL! And never one time did they even think about good old "White-Out". Duh! We still have to use that at least every once in a while!
